Web19 de set. de 2014 · Practice gratitude. Thankfulness has a multitude of benefits: Research shows it makes us happier, less stressed and even more optimistic -- and according to a March 2014 study published in the journal Psychological Science, it can also help us practice more patience. Patient-centred care is about treating a person receiving healthcare with dignity and respect and involving them in all decisions about their health. This type of care is also called ‘person-centred care’.
